At the forefront of this transformation are the smart toilets. These are no longer mere fixtures but sophisticated diagnostic hubs. Integrated sensors can analyze waste for key health indicators, from hydration levels to early signs of infection. Imagine a toilet that, with every flush, silently gathers data that could alert you to potential health issues long before they become serious. This data can then be securely transmitted to your personal health apps, providing a continuous, non-invasive health monitoring system. Beyond diagnostics, these toilets offer unparalleled comfort and hygiene, featuring heated seats, bidet functions with adjustable pressure and temperature, and even gentle air dryers, all controlled via intuitive interfaces or voice commands.

The humble showerhead is also undergoing its own algorithmic upgrade. Smart shower systems go far beyond simple temperature and flow control. They can create personalized showering experiences, recalling preferred settings for water pressure, temperature, and even duration. Some advanced systems leverage AI to analyze water usage patterns, offering insights into conservation efforts and potentially adjusting flow to optimize efficiency without sacrificing comfort. Imagine stepping into a shower that remembers your specific preferences, starting at the perfect temperature and offering a customized spray pattern, all initiated with a simple voice command or a tap on a linked smartphone app. This isn’t just about convenience; it’s about tailoring a daily ritual to individual needs, potentially easing morning routines for busy professionals or providing a therapeutic experience for those seeking relaxation.

Mirrors are shedding their purely reflective skin to become interactive information displays. Smart mirrors can display weather forecasts, news headlines, appointment reminders, and even personalized health summaries derived from data gathered by other smart bathroom devices. Some are equipped with advanced lighting systems that mimic natural daylight, aiding in skin analysis and makeup application, while others offer integrated sound systems for enjoying music or podcasts during your morning preparations. The surface that once simply showed your reflection now actively participates in your day, becoming a portal to information and a facilitator of your grooming and wellness routines.

The integration of these disparate elements is where the true algorithmic power of the modern bathroom emerges. AI algorithms are beginning to orchestrate the entire experience. For example, a smart motion sensor might detect you entering the bathroom, automatically activating ambient lighting and the smart mirror. Your preferred morning program could then be suggested on the mirror’s display. As you step into the shower, the system recalls your personalized settings. Throughout your routine, sensors discreetly gather data, contributing to your overall wellness profile. This interconnectedness creates a seamless, intuitive, and hyper-personalized environment that adapts to your presence and preferences.
